Union Agriculture Minister says farm mechanisation gaining momentum in India

Union Agriculture Minister Radha Mohan Singh said that farm mechanisation is gaining momentum in India despite challenges of uncertain power supply to small farms and lack of skills to operate modern equipment. 

More farm machinery is being used as the government is promoting it in a big way with sufficient funds, Singh said, hoping that the farm mechanisation sector grows rapidly for sustainable development of agriculture.

 "In future, it is necessary to establish a link between the possibility of sustainable development of agricultural mechanisation without neglecting the lack of energy and environmental degradation due to low availability of fossil fuels and its high cost," Singh said addressing a meeting of the Consultative Committee on Agriculture.
